HC Deb 17 June 1889 vol 337 c6
MR. JOHN ELLIS (Nottinghamshire, Rushcliffe)

I beg to ask the Solicitor General for Ireland how many of the 10,752 tenants whose tenancies were determined by notices under Section 7 of "The Land Act (Ireland), 1887," in the year 1888 had applied to the Land Commission for judicial rents; how many of the cases had been adjudicated; and, how many remained non-judicial?

THE SOLICITOR GENERAL FOR IRELAND (Mr. MADDEN,) University of Dublin

Inquiries have been made both of the Land Commission and of the Clerks of the Peace relating to the question of the hon. Member, but I am informed that no records are in existence from which it is possible to procure the information which is desired.
